Hi guys advice please!!
Where do I send the passport in canada for visa stamping i got my BOWP ,i need to go back home they need a visa to re-entry.....
 
raj kamal said:
Hi guys advice please!!
Where do I send the passport in canada for visa stamping i got my BOWP ,i need to go back home they need a visa to re-entry.....

BOWP does not allow you to re-enter Canada. You need to apply for a temporary resident visa.
Look up "Apply for a new temporary resident visa from within Canada" on google and you will find a link to the application process

I went to my Local Visa Office yesterday to see them in person. They allow this only on the first Tuesday of each month. They only open at 08:00 am but I was told to be there earlier on another forum as there are a lot of people enquiring on their files. I arrived there 06:15 am, was third in line and by 08:00am ther were +- 40 people in line.

I went in 08:00 am. They checked on the online system first and then pulled my original file to show me they received my original PCC's. The consultant said I will receive MR within a week or two. I then asked how long after medicals for PPR, she said between a couple of weeks or a month.

I am so excited that my file is finally moving into the right direction!
